More than half of the Germans dissatisfied with Chancellor Merz!

A current survey shows that the majority of Germans are dissatisfied with the work of Federal Chancellor Friedrich Merz. According to the results, 52 percent of the respondents negatively evaluate his previous office, while only 38 percent are satisfied. 10 percent of the survey participants were neutrally expressed. Dissatisfaction in East Germany is particularly pronounced, where only 24 percent Merz finds satisfactory, while 62 percent criticize it. In West Germany it is at least 40 percent who agree to his work. All over the entire population, the consent to Merz remains behind the expectations, especially among the supporters of the Union, where this number increases to 74 percent. This information was collected by n-tv and Statista .

The latest surveys also recall the AfD's upswing, which has established itself as the second strongest force and has the largest opposition fraction. Despite the survey values, the CDU/CSU election winner remains, but they missed the 30 percent mark. The continuing dissatisfaction with current political decisions could have a decisive influence in future elections, such as in terms of internal security and social justice.
